The correct operation of F-PROT Antivirus can be tested with a special test file known as
EICAR Standard Anti-virus Test file.
Naturally, the European Institute of Computer Anti-virus Research (EICAR) is a simple file
which behaves exactly like a virus but when executed, EICAR.COM will display the
text 'EICAR-STANDARD-ANTIVIRUS-TEST-FILE' and exit.
We do not include the EICAR test file with the package to avoid alarming anyone running F-PROT Antivirus on the
package.
Testing F-PROT Antivirus automatic scanners:
- Run Notepad.
- Write the following single line in the document. We recommend using "Copy and Paste" method.
X5O!P%@AP[4\PZX54(P^)7CC)7}$EICAR-STANDARD-ANTIVIRUS-TEST-FILE!$H+H*
- Save the file and name it EICAR.COM on your Desktop.
- Open the file. F-PROT Antivirus will automatically disinfect the file.

Testing F-PROT Antivirus manual scanning:
- Disable the automatic file system protection.
- Run Notepad.
- Write the following single line in the document. We recommend using "Copy and Paste" method.
X5O!P%@AP[4\PZX54(P^)7CC)7}$EICAR-STANDARD-ANTIVIRUS-TEST-FILE!$H+H*
- Save the file and name it EICAR.COM on your Desktop.
- Right-click the EICAR.COM file and select "Scan with F-PROT Antivirus".
F-PROT Antivirus will automatically disinfect the file.
- Remember to enable the automatic file system protection when you have finished testing!
If the test is successful then, F-PROT Antivirus will display that EICAR test file is disinfected, which means F-PROT Antivirus is working properly.
